What Are White-Label SaaS ERP Backup Services?
Backup services involve the automated creation, storage, and management of ERP data copies to enable recovery from accidental deletion, corruption, or system failures.
In white-label SaaS ERP, backups must be tenant-aware, secure, and aligned with recovery objectives.
Why Backup Services Are Critical for White-Label ERP
- ERP systems store mission-critical business data
- Human error, software bugs, and cyber incidents can cause data loss
- Compliance regulations require data protection and retention
Reliable backups form the foundation of data resilience.
Core Components of ERP Backup Services
1. Backup Types and Coverage
Different data requires different backup approaches.
- Full, incremental, and differential backups
- Application, database, and file-level backups
- Configuration and metadata backups
Comprehensive coverage ensures complete recovery.
2. Backup Automation and Scheduling
Automation reduces risk.
- Scheduled and policy-driven backups
- Event-based backup triggers
- Monitoring of backup success and failures
Automated backups ensure consistency.
3. Data Security and Encryption
Backups must be protected.
- Encryption at rest and in transit
- Secure key management
- Access-controlled backup repositories
Security prevents unauthorized data access.
4. Multi-Tenant Backup Management
White-label ERP platforms support multiple tenants.
- Tenant-isolated backup storage
- Tenant-specific backup policies
- Independent restore operations
This ensures data separation and flexibility.
5. Retention Policies and Compliance
Backup retention must follow regulations.
- Configurable retention periods
- Legal and regulatory compliance alignment
- Secure deletion after retention expiry
Retention policies balance compliance and cost.
6. Backup Storage and Geo-Redundancy
Storage strategy impacts resilience.
- Offsite and cloud-based storage
- Geo-redundant backup locations
- Cost-optimized storage tiers
Geo-redundancy protects against regional failures.
7. Restore and Validation Procedures
Backups are valuable only if restorable.
- Granular data restore options
- Full system restoration
- Periodic restore testing and validation
Validation ensures backup reliability.

How often should ERP backups be taken?
Backup frequency depends on business needs, but many platforms perform daily or near-real-time backups.
Are backups isolated per tenant in white-label ERP?
Yes. Tenant-aware backup strategies ensure data isolation and independent recovery.
